In the Ghana Electric Transporters Market, several challenges are faced, including limited infrastructure for charging stations, high initial costs of electric vehicles, and concerns over the reliability of the vehicles in a country with less developed road networks. Additionally, issues related to battery life and maintenance, as well as the availability of spare parts and skilled technicians, pose significant obstacles to the widespread adoption of electric transporters in Ghana. Furthermore, the lack of government incentives and policies to promote the use of electric vehicles hinders market growth. Overcoming these challenges will require investments in charging infrastructure, awareness campaigns to educate consumers, and collaboration between the government and private sector to create a supportive environment for the electric transport industry.

The Ghanaian government has implemented several policies to promote the use of electric transporters in the country. These policies include tax incentives and rebates for the purchase of electric vehicles, as well as initiatives to develop charging infrastructure across the nation. Additionally, the government has set targets for increasing the adoption of electric transporters in both the public and private sectors, aiming to reduce carbon emissions and dependence on fossil fuels. To support these efforts, various regulations have been put in place to ensure the safety and reliability of electric vehicles on Ghana`s roads, including standards for vehicle charging and battery disposal. Overall, the government`s policies are focused on accelerating the transition to a more sustainable and environmentally friendly transportation system in Ghana.
